Feby 7th Ordered four cars hotbed manure for {?} 20 March 1st, 10th + 15th also a few seeds in states from Condor Bros. Rockford Ill {i think this is abbreviated from Illinois}. 1oz {?} peppers, 1lb bag {Tom?} pumpkin on, 1oz Cannon Bull cabbage. Stokes seed farms Co. Moose town N.J. 4oz Ruby Giant, 1oz Neapolitan pepper, 1oz Copenhagen market cabbages.

Feby 8th Mild today. heavy south west winds + thawing. Hockey team Ham. beat Oakville in the third game to break tie score, score 5 to 2 last night.

February 9th Colder again and very icy. Went to Ham. on bus and got a pair of truck chains.

February 10th Bright + cool but thawing in the sun went to Hamilton to {?} for two loads orange crates got 287 at 10¢ – $28.70, also got 3000 –11qts in from Glovers. Got truck license today cost $25.

February 11th Sunday. Fair + cold.

February 12th Received 50 Apple from {Huletion} Bros + 71 from Geo Kemp at 25¢. Total cost with freight $39.29. Started storming again from the east tonight. Grimsley won from Ham. beavers on Saturday night which gives Grimsley group honours in, the {?} O.H.A

February 13th Cloudy + cool had Alderson up the Gray Dot. Out trying to sell a cow.

February 14 Very cold, heavy west winds plus snow squalls. No mail man today. Wonder what the trouble can be (too cold)
